Types of Double Glazed Window Hinges

UPVC window hinges are often ignored and forgotten about but they have a crucial task to perform. Oiling the hinges every now and then will save you energy and money as well as keep you warm!

Choosing the right uPVC hinge for your double glazed window is simple if you know what to look for. The thickness of the hinge arm (13mm and 17mm) and the track outer diameter (18mm) are the most important things to look for.

Double-glazed windows hinges are an essential element and it's vital that they work properly. If your UPVC window hinge replacement near me is difficult to close or open, or there are visible gaps between the frame and the sash It's likely that they require adjustment. These gaps allow air into your home even when your windows are closed and can lead to draughts.

You can check your hinges are the correct size by measuring the gap that exists between the frame and sash using a ruler. Then, you can utilize this information to place an order for the correct hinges online. When measuring, it's important to take the length of the hinge starting from where it is attached to the frame (H measurement) and not the hinge's arm. Hinges are available in two standard heights for stacks 13mm and 17mm.

Aluminum

Aluminum window hinges are an essential element of modern windows, providing an array of benefits that elevate the performance and aesthetics of architectural designs. They are recognized for their outstanding durability, strength and quiet operation. Their low maintenance and versatile design makes them suitable for a variety of commercial and residential applications. They are also environmentally conscious and offer superior weather resistance.

Unlike steel hinges, aluminum is impervious to degradation and corrosion. Aluminum is a fantastic choice for harsh environments where moisture and salt sprays can cause damage to other materials. The metal's strength makes it impervious to breaking, bending and tearing. This will extend the life span of your windows. Aluminum hinges are also a great option for areas with coastal regions and frequent rainfall because they can withstand high winds without compromising the quality of the frame or window panes.

To determine which type of hinge you need, first check the size of the track. Examine the hinge's arm that is connected to the window opening. If the arm is straight it's a hinge of 13mm, whereas an arm that is kinked is a 17mm hinge.
